What is a Mixed Number?
Before we tackle 63/4, let's define what a mixed number is. That said, a proper fraction has a numerator (the top number) smaller than its denominator (the bottom number), for example, 1/2, 3/4, or 7/8. On top of that, a mixed number represents a quantity greater than one. A mixed number combines a whole number and a proper fraction. Here's a good example: 2 1/2 represents two whole units and an additional half.
Converting an Improper Fraction to a Mixed Number
An improper fraction has a numerator equal to or larger than its denominator. Even so, this indicates a value greater than or equal to one. The fraction 63/4 is an improper fraction because 63 (numerator) is larger than 4 (denominator). To convert it to a mixed number, we need to determine how many whole numbers are contained within the fraction and what part is remaining.
Method 1: Division
The most straightforward method involves simple division. Divide the numerator (63) by the denominator (4):
63 ÷ 4 = 15 with a remainder of 3
- The quotient (15) becomes the whole number part of the mixed number.
- The remainder (3) becomes the numerator of the fractional part.
- The denominator remains the same (4).
Because of this, 63/4 as a mixed number is 15 3/4.

Common Mistakes to Avoid
Several common errors can occur when converting improper fractions to mixed numbers:
- Incorrect division: Carefully perform the division to ensure the quotient and remainder are accurate.
- Misplacing the remainder: The remainder becomes the numerator of the fractional part, not the denominator.
- Forgetting the denominator: The denominator of the mixed number's fraction remains the same as the original improper fraction's denominator.
- Not simplifying the fractional part: Always simplify the fractional part if possible. Here's a good example: if you obtained 15 6/8, you should simplify it to 15 3/4.
Let's Practice with More Examples
Let's solidify your understanding by working through a few more examples:
-
Convert 27/5 to a mixed number: 27 ÷ 5 = 5 with a remainder of 2. So, 27/5 = 5 2/5.
-
Convert 41/6 to a mixed number: 41 ÷ 6 = 6 with a remainder of 5. Because of this, 41/6 = 6 5/6.
-
Convert 100/12 to a mixed number: 100 ÷ 12 = 8 with a remainder of 4. Which means, 100/12 = 8 4/12. This can be simplified to 8 1/3.
Remember to always check your work and simplify the fractional part where possible.
Frequently Asked Questions (FAQs)
Q: Can all improper fractions be converted to mixed numbers?
A: Yes, all improper fractions can be converted to mixed numbers. This is because an improper fraction always represents a value greater than or equal to one.
Q: Is it better to use improper fractions or mixed numbers?
A: It depends on the context. Sometimes, improper fractions are more convenient for calculations, especially multiplication and division. Other times, mixed numbers provide a clearer and more intuitive representation of the quantity.
Q: How do I convert a mixed number back to an improper fraction?
A: To convert a mixed number to an improper fraction, multiply the whole number by the denominator, add the numerator, and keep the same denominator. Take this: 15 3/4 becomes (15 * 4) + 3 / 4 = 63/4.
Q: What if the remainder is zero after dividing the numerator by the denominator?
A: If the remainder is zero, it means the improper fraction is already a whole number. Day to day, for example, 12/4 = 3. There's no fractional part.
